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Diagnosed with chronic diseases by a secondary or higher-level hospital, with the number of chronic disease types = 2. Chronic disease types are defined as chronic diseases according to the 11th edition of the International Classification of Diseases, self-reported and confirmed by a hospital, including hypertension, diabetes, hyperlipidemia, coronary atherosclerotic heart disease,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, etc. 2. Age >= 40 years old; 3. Conscious, without intellectual disability, and having complete cognitive and behavioral abilities. 4. Informed consent and voluntary participation in this study.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Those who are unable to cooperate or have difficulty in communication due to deafness, dumb, dementia, etc; 2. Those with critical or severe diseases and unable to cooperate in completing the study.
